Impacts of Global Change on Mediterranean Forests and Their Services

TL;DR: If changes in climate, land use and other components of global change, such as pollution and overexploitation of resources, continue, the resilience of many forests will likely be exceeded, altering their structure and function and changing, mostly decreasing, their capacity to continue to provide their current services.

Temporal trends in the enhanced vegetation index and spring weather predict seed production in Mediterranean oaks

TL;DR: The results indicated, apparently for the first time, that reproduction in masting species could be detected and partly predicted by remotely sensed vegetative indices and fully supported recent studies that have associated short-term photosynthate production with seed production.
